99010000991 has 6 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 108829174776. Its totient is φ = 90009091700.

The previous prime is 99010000967. The next prime is 99010001023. The reversal of 99010000991 is 19900001099.

It is a happy number.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 99010000991 - 210 = 99009999967 is a prime.

It is a Duffinian number.

It is a congruent number.

It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(99010000591)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written in 5 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 409132115 + ... + 409132356.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(18138195796).

Almost surely, 299010000991 is an apocalyptic number.

99010000991 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(9819173785).

99010000991 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.

99010000991 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.

The sum of its prime factors is 818264493 (or 818264482 counting only the distinct ones).

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 6561, while the sum is 38.

The spelling of 99010000991 in words is "ninety-nine billion, ten million, nine hundred ninety-one", and thus it is an aban number.

Divisors: 1 11 121 818264471 9000909181 99010000991
